CPE/CE/MCLE

This seminar is worth 8 Hours of CPE/CE/MCLE* credit.

Live attendees will have their attendance recorded by a proctor.

Online attendees will be presented with 24 polling questions over the course of the seminar. These polling questions will appear randomly during the presentation without prompting, per NASBA requirements. Attendees will have 45 seconds to respond. Missing a few polling questions will not disqualify you from receiving CPE.


This course is approved for the following categories of credit:

MCLE (Minimum Continuing Legal Education): Taxation Law; Certified Public Accountants; Enrolled Agents

Field of Study: Taxation

National Registry of CPE Sponsor Number: 128917

IRS Continuing Education Provider Number: NN2YF-T-00003-15-O

 

*The Tax Resolution Institute offers CPE credit to CPAs and EAs in all 50 states.  The Tax Resolution Institute has been approved by CA and KS to offer MCLE credit to practicing attorneys.  State reciprocity rules and non-MCLE requirement rules indicate that MCLE/CE credit may also be given in AK, AR, CO, CT, FL, HI, ME, MD, MA, MI, MT, NJ, NY, ND, OR, SD, WV and WI.  Check with your State to confirm that credit may be given.
